A heptagon has all equal side lengths.
Which statements are true about the reflectional symmetry of a regular heptagon? Select two options.
It has only 1 line of reflectional symmetry.
A line of symmetry will connect 2 vertices.
A line of symmetry will connect a vertex and a midpoint of an opposite side.
It has 7-fold symmetry.
A line of symmetry will connect the midpoints of 2 opposite sides.

The true statements are:
- A line of symmetry will connect a vertex and a midpoint of an opposite side.
- It has 7-fold symmetry.
Explanation: a regular heptagon has dihedral symmetry D7 — 7 rotations (including the identity) and 7 reflection axes. For odd n (n=7) each reflection axis passes through a vertex and the midpoint of the opposite side, so there are 7 such axes. The other options are false.
